Samuel L. Jackson to change the conversation about dementia
I am delighted to share with you the next chapter of #ShareTheOrange which launches today. This year we have joined forces with Hollywood superstar Samuel L. Jackson to change the conversation about dementia. As with previous #ShareTheOrange campaigns, the aim is to highlight how dementia is caused by physical diseases that can be targeted through research. It is not an inevitable part of getting older.
Samuel’s family has been impacted by Alzheimer’s more than most, having had six relatives diagnosed with the disease. The 2019 film once again uses an orange to symbolise the weight of brain matter lost as the condition develops, visualising the connections that can be lost for those affected, but importantly demonstrating the potential we have through research to make life-changing breakthroughs possible for dementia.
